Athena Core Technologies Finds New Leadership with Jorge Rodriguez
Dar es Salaam, Tanzania: In a strategic move to enhance East Africa's digital ecosystem,
Athena Core Technologies has appointed
Jorge Rodriguez as the new Chief Executive Officer. This decision comes as part of Athena's comprehensive plan to bolster the region's digital transformation amid increasing global connectivity demands.
With over three decades of experience in telecom and technology sectors, Rodriguez brings a wealth of knowledge, having previously led significant transformations at multinational corporations such as
América Móvil and
Sorenson Communications. His background in scaling connectivity services and creating operational efficiencies positions him well to navigate Athena's ambitious roadmap.
The Digital Backbone of East Africa
Athena is on a mission to construct a resilient digital backbone across East Africa, deploying an integrated digital infrastructure that includes subsea capacity, carrier-neutral data centers, and extensive fiber networks. This infrastructure is crucial for enabling a
cloud-first economy in a region that has historically struggled with connectivity.
As Zahir Mulla, Executive Chair of Athena, noted, “Jorge's expertise represents a significant asset as we expand our subsea and terrestrial investments. His leadership is expected to propel Athena as a market leader, providing secure and affordable digital infrastructure at a continental scale.”
Focus on Connectivity and Cloud Solutions
Rodriguez expressed enthusiasm about the role, stating, “Athena's mission aligns seamlessly with the pressing needs of East Africa—providing carrier-neutral capacity, modern colocation, and strong terrestrial connectivity to bridge the digital gap.” His immediate focus will involve delivering diverse pathways with low latency and high reliability, thereby fostering accelerated digitization for businesses and individual users alike.
The strategic initiatives outlined by Rodriguez and his team center on several key priorities:
- - Network Diversity and Resilience: Enhancing subsea access points and establishing protected terrestrial routes to mitigate disruptions.
- - Neutral Data Center Capacity: Developing facilities that are cloud- and carrier-neutral to improve cost-effectiveness and latency.
- - Nationwide Fiber Reach: Stretching backbones and last-mile connectivity to ensure economically vital areas and underserved communities benefit from improved services.
- - Public-Private Partnerships: Collaborating closely with government bodies and regulatory agencies to promote a cloud-centric, inclusive digital economy.

Rodriguez's impressive trajectory in the tech landscape is highlighted by numerous accolades, including being named
Transformational CEO of the Year by
TITAN and earning recognition from
HITEC for his executive impact. He holds advanced credentials from
Columbia University and the
Rochester Institute of Technology, and proudly serves on several corporate boards, enhancing his ability to bring a wealth of governance experience to Athena.
